Chapter 316: Chaos Bead

Chapter 316 Chaos Bead

And her father, the late crown prince of Tiansheng Kingdom, is now Emperor Zhaowu.

He regained his memory, joined forces with his old subordinates to launch a coup, and took back the throne that belonged to him from his foolish brother.

He abandoned her mother and left her behind.

He seemed to have forgotten this past and was enjoying his dream of becoming an emperor within the deep palace walls.

He holds great power, has women on both sides, and lives a happy life.

Recalling this, Di Ran's brows were filled with sarcasm.

The sweet words and vows of love of the past have now become a joke.

If her mother knew what would happen today, would she regret it?

Di Ran drooped his eyelashes slightly, hiding the complexity in his eyes, and smiled softly with his red lips.

Forget it, the past is like smoke, reminiscing about it will only add to your troubles, why bother?

After calming his mind, Di Ran opened his eyes again and looked down at the Chaos Pearl in his hand.

This thing was worn around her neck by her mother in her previous life since she was born. At that time, it was black and looked like an inconspicuous little stone, so it did not attract anyone's attention.

She was bullied by the son of the family who took her in. She was hit on the forehead by a stone and it was bleeding. The stone sucked a lot of her blood.

Afterwards, the stone disappeared inexplicably and she cried for a long time.

It was not until she returned to the Witch Clan and cultivated her spiritual power to a certain level that she discovered that thing in her spiritual bones.

But at that time it was no longer a stone, but had turned into a bead.

And as she practiced, it also stole her spiritual energy.

She didn't know what it was or why it happened.

It was not until she accidentally heard a member of the Wu Clan mention the clan's treasure, the Chaos Pearl, that she went to check the Chaos Pearl out of curiosity, and found out that the thing in her body was the Chaos Pearl.

When her mother was captured and brought back to the Witch Clan, she did not tell them the whereabouts of the Chaos Pearl, so the Witch Clan has been searching for it ever since.

However, only the high priests of all generations knew the appearance of the Chaos Pearl, and the people of the Witch Clan believed that the Chaos Pearl was a very special pearl.

After she was taken back to the Wu Clan, she was asked whether her mother had given her the Chaos Pearl. However, she did not know what the Chaos Pearl was at the time, so the Wu Clan members gave up when they did not find it.

Later, she discovered that the stone she had been wearing since childhood was the Chaos Pearl in her body, but she did not tell the people of the Witch Clan.

The human heart is unpredictable, and no one can guarantee that no one is coveting it.

Moreover, the bead has become one with her and is closely related to her spiritual veins. If it is forcibly taken out, not only will her cultivation be destroyed, but she will also become a useless person.

The current chief of the Wu clan will protect her for the sake of her mother, but there are four elders above the chief.

If they knew she had the Chaos Orb, they would definitely take it away by force. So, she didn't tell anyone.

She thought that the Chaos Orb was no longer in her body after her death, but unexpectedly she found that it was still there.

It’s just that the spiritual energy in this world is thin, and she doesn’t want to go back to her previous life, so she has been doing whatever she wants after reincarnation, and she is not that serious about cultivation.

It was not until she met Axie again that she realized she had not let it go.

She needs to become stronger so that she can protect the people she wants.

She has been practicing in the Chaos Pearl these days and has not paid attention to what is happening outside.

I wonder if Axie misses her?

Thinking of Ji Yunxie, the corners of Di Ran's lips curled up, and there was a drowning tenderness in his eyes.

As I walked out of the palace gate, two servants came towards me.

They were all stunned when they saw Di Ran. When did the prince come back?

Although it was surprising, we still had to observe the proper etiquette.

The two of them bowed quickly: "Greetings, Your Majesty!"

"Ah."

Di Ran's eyes were indifferent. He knew that these two people were servants serving in the main courtyard, so he asked.

"Where's Axie?"

The two servants were slightly stunned, and then responded respectfully: "Your Majesty, Master Yunxie and Miss Feng have gone out."

Di Ran frowned: "Where did you go?"

The servant shook his head: "I don't know."

Seeing this, Di Ran waved his hand and sent the two people away.

"Emperor One~"

The woman in black tights appeared behind him: "I'm here!"

"Check~"

"Yes."
